

Welcome to the PCAG
The Prairie Division of the Canadian Association of Geographers (PCAG) strives to support the objectives of The Canadian Association of Geographers (CAG) in the encouragement of geographical study, teaching, research and application of geographic knowledge in Manitoba, Saskatchewan, Nunavut, northern Ontario, and North Dakota. All members in good standing of the Canadian Association of Geographers residing in Manitoba, Saskatchewan, Nunavut, and the American state of North Dakota, or affiliated with Lakehead University are automatically registered as members of the Division. Membership may also be accorded to other members of the Canadian Association of Geographers upon request to the Secretary/Treasurer of the PCAG.

Prairie Perspectives - Call for papers!
Prairie Perspectives invites original manuscripts on any subject relating to geography of the prairies or other geographical scope authored by scholars located in the prairies. Prairie Perspectives is a double-blind, peer-reviewed journal published by the PCAG. Please forward your intent to submit a manuscript for consideration to pcag@cag-acg.ca by December 1st, 2022. Completed manuscripts will be due by March 1st, 2023. Previous issues of Prairie Perspectives and a link to manuscript style guidelines can be found here.
